Damaged Siding Replacement in West Hartford, CT
Damaged siding replacement services address the need to remove and replace compromised or deteriorated siding materials on residential properties. This service typically covers projects involving cracked, warped, rotted, or otherwise damaged siding made from materials such as vinyl, wood, fiber cement, or aluminum. Homeowners often seek siding replacement after weather-related incidents, aging, or when signs of wear and tear become visible, including peeling, bubbling, or mold growth. Understanding the extent of damage and the type of siding currently installed can help property owners determine whether a full replacement or repairs are appropriate.
Before requesting siding replacement,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, including the removal process, material options, and the expected impact on the home's exterior. It’s also helpful to consider the compatibility of new siding with existing exterior features and the potential benefits of upgrading to more durable or energy-efficient materials. Clarifying these details can ensure that the project meets both aesthetic preferences and long-term performance expectations.

Damaged Siding Replacement Questions
What are signs of damaged siding? Visible cracks, warping, or missing pieces indicate siding damage that may require replacement.
Can damaged siding affect property value? Yes, compromised siding can reduce curb appeal and potentially impact property value over time.
What types of siding can be replaced? Common options include vinyl, wood, fiber cement, and aluminum siding.
Is siding replacement necessary after storm damage? Storm damage that causes cracks, holes, or detachment usually warrants siding replacement to protect the structure.
